ADOPT-IPM is an EU-China joint action set up by a total of 32 partners from EU Member States, as well as from China and the United Kingdom, including research institutes, universities, small enterprises and extension services. The project is funded under the Horizon Europe framework programme for a period of four years (December 2022-November 2026). ADOPT-IPM aims at the development, optimisation and implementation of Integrated Pest Management (IPM) tools and packages, and ultimately at the reduction of the dependency of farmers on conventional chemical pesticides in the EU Member States, China, and associated countries.

On November 28, 2024, our partners from the Università di Catania (UNICT), in collaboration with AGROBIO, organized a successful Demo Day at Econatura Group’s organic farm in Ragusa, Sicily. ??The event showcased innovative Integrated Pest Management (IPM) strategies for tomato farms, including the use of alternative plants like Verbena x hybrida and Sesamum indicum to manage pests such as the South American tomato pinworm (Tuta absoluta). Participants explored experimental greenhouses, observed treatments combining tomatoes with alternative plants, and engaged in innovative pest and beneficial insect sampling activities.?? ??The interactive seminar featured insightful presentations and discussions led by experts from UNICT and AGROBIO, fostering knowledge exchange among farmers, agronomists, researchers, and students. This Demo Day emphasized the importance of collaboration and innovation in advancing sustainable agriculture. ?? Benjamin Gard from the CTIFL is organising a field day tomorrow in Balandran (FR) on lettuces to demonstrate the results of a trial on novel IPM techniques. The CTIFL tested two ADOPT-IPM innovations: (1) a biological control botanical strategy through lettuce a mass release of eggs of the predator Chrysoperla lucasina using the PULZOR device developed by the partner IFTECH, and (2) the combination of this lever (C. lucasina eggs) with the use of flower strips alongside of the tunnel to enhance the presence of natural enemies of aphids. Flower strips were composed of the following species: Calendula officinalis, Lobularia maritima, Achillea millefolium, Secale cereale, and Hordeum vulgare. Those strategies were compared to a conventional strategy used by growers in France which is the application of spirotetramat (MOVENTO) an effective insecticide to control aphids.
